All models of Comac double pinch style profile bending machine can be equipped with electronic automatic control systems to improve accuracy and consistency of jobs and enhance the rate of automation.
These controls are simple 2-axis programmable positioning devices, or CNC controls.
Programmable positioning devices are useful to join straight parts to bent parts and to perform multiple-passes jobs in a more consistent sequence of operations.
CNC controls are required to accomplish multi-radius curves to be produced in medium-large batches with high consistency and excellent quality of transitions between the different radii, even with difficult materials such as thin-wall tubes.
This can be achieved by controlling simultaneously three axes, i.e. the profile feeding and the positions of the bending rolls.
Among the hundreds of parts produced with CNC-controlled rolls, some samples are: greenhouses, handrails of cruise boats, conveyor rails, variable-pitch pipe coils for boilers, pancake coils, commercial signs, etc.
Two versions of CNC control are available; both are based on industry standard non-proprietary hardware (PLC’s and Industrial PC’s worldwide available), in order to insure immediate availability of spare parts and local technical support.

The production of elbow parts for air ducts starts with a rollforming proc-ess. This operation seams the blank and creates one part for the lock. In the second step the internal and outside elbow duct cheeks will be rounded on the requested radius.
Traditional rounding machines use one part rolls. Since the part comes with the rollformed seam, traditional rounding machines can offer only some poor and costly compromises. Setting the rolls to the seam thickness results in poor radii. Stronger settings will damage the seam and in the long term also the rolls.
The RAS VENTIrounder for the air duct production rounds sheet metal elbow cheeks with pre-formed Snap Lock or Pittsburgh seams. The result are perfect workpieces without the need of additional spacer parts.
After having moved the rounding rings along the working length and set them to the approximate blank width, you can start rounding the blank. The rings round the sheet metal without touching the seams. Therefore the seams keep their geometry during the rounding process. A gear-brake motor with variable speed can be operated from a single phase outlet. |

The TURBObend plus metal folding system is available in working lengths of 3200 mm and 2540 mm with a capacity of up to 2 mm mild steel material thickness. An extremely clever tooling system offers box production capabilities for up to 110 mm deep boxes. These tools come in two different shapes: the front-free tool for long return flanges and rear-free tools for narrow parts. In addition, the folding beam tools can be also segmented.
With the revolutionary RAS programming the operator can use his finger as a pencil. He simply paints a flange and sizes it to the right dimension and angle. He can see the shape of the finished part on the screen. The CADalyzer automatically creates the program using the part drawing. A bend sequence simulation shows if the part can be produced. The CADalyzer shows the program, the finished part and the actual bend sequence all at a time.
For material thickness changes the folding beam automatically adjusts itself in less than 5 seconds. The CNC backgauge positions the part to any dimension within the standard backstop depth of 1550 mm. The backstop can be extended to 3050 mm for really large parts. The operator can also work from the rear. This allows him to handle even large and heavy parts just by himself. |

The servo-hydraulic folding machines RAS 74.20 - 40 offer a working length of 2040 to 4060 mm and runs sheet thicknesses up to 5 mm. The integrated backgauging and sheet support system, which employs multiple pop-up stops, positions the part accurately to +/- 0,1 mm in less than 2 seconds to any dimension between 10 and 1550 mm. The pop-up fingers can disappear for parts rotation. Ball casters simplify material handling with heavy panels. When parts are large, optional backgauge extensions make it easy to handle the part.
A automatic tool clamping system allows a tool change in seconds. The precision tools are heat-treated, plasma-nitrided and ground. They come in easy to handle pieces and are available in heights as deep as 250 mm. The CNC lower beam and folding beam adjustment automatically prepares the machine for varying material thicknesses and bend radii.
You will be fascinated about the easy to use Touch&More CNC. It controls all 6 axes. The operator just draws the part with his finger and the Touch&More CNC instantly creates the program. The software comes with a tool library, a tool setup instruction and tells the operator line by line how to handle the part. |

The GIGAbend folding system brings two features together: power and speed. The machines offer a capacity of 3200 x 6 mm or 4060 x 5 mm. The machine comes standard with a 1550 mm CNC backgauge. For larger blanks a J- or U-shape back-gauge can be added with a gauging depth of up to 4050 mm.
This is the first time that a folding system combines the characteristics of high clamping pressures and speed. The additional clamping pressure holds the blanks safely and securely during folding. 120 metric tons of clamping pressure insure that the GIGAbend delivers more than adequate power to close hems. In addition there are no compromises in terms of speed. With 60 mm/s the upper clamping beam closes and opens quickly and dynamically.
The bending quality comes to perfection with the dynamic crowning system. Sensors measure the real beam deflection and automatically compensate for any unevenness. This system will create perfect parts on thick and thin materials, no matter where the part is being bent along the folding length.
The machine is complete with Touch&More control. Never before has programming been so amazingly easy. The operator can use his finger as a pencil. He simply draws the part with his finger and the control automatically creates and simulates the folding sequence. |
